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about rehab centers and addiction treatment in Tanner, Alabama

What addiction treatment options are available in Tanner, AL, and do I need to travel to nearby cities for comprehensive care?

Tanner itself has limited dedicated rehab facilities, but it is part of the larger Limestone County area with access to outpatient programs, counseling services, and support groups like AA/NA meetings locally. For inpatient or residential treatment, residents often travel to nearby cities such as Huntsville or Decatur, which offer a wider range of options including detox, intensive outpatient programs (IOP), and long-term rehab centers within a 30-minute drive.

How can I verify if a rehab center near Tanner, AL, accepts my insurance or offers payment assistance?

Contact local providers directly, such as those in Athens or Huntsville, and ask about their accepted insurance plans—many in Alabama accept Medicaid, Medicare, and private insurers. Additionally, you can reach out to the Alabama Department of Mental Health or use online tools like SAMHSA's treatment locator to find facilities with sliding-scale fees or state-funded options available to Limestone County residents.

Are there any specialized addiction treatment programs in the Tanner area for specific substances like opioids or alcohol?

Yes, nearby facilities in Huntsville and Athens offer specialized programs for opioid use disorder, including medication-assisted treatment (MAT) with Suboxone or methadone, as well as alcohol detox and rehab. Local organizations, such as the Limestone County Health Department, can provide referrals to these targeted services, which are crucial given Alabama's high rates of opioid and alcohol addiction.

What local support resources are available in Tanner, AL, for families affected by addiction?

Families in Tanner can access support through local Al-Anon and Nar-Anon meetings held in nearby Athens or Decatur, which provide peer support for loved ones. Additionally, the Limestone County Commission on Aging and local churches often offer counseling and educational workshops to help families navigate addiction challenges and connect with community resources.

How do I choose the right rehab center in the Tanner, AL, area, and what should I consider during the selection process?

Consider factors like the center's accreditation, treatment approaches (e.g., evidence-based therapies), proximity to Tanner, and whether they offer aftercare planning. It's advisable to consult with a primary care doctor in Limestone County or use referral services from the Alabama Recovery Center to match your specific needs with nearby facilities in Huntsville or Decatur, ensuring you receive personalized and effective care.

Understanding your local options is key. While Tanner itself is a peaceful community, it is wonderfully positioned near comprehensive addiction treatment services. The larger Huntsville metropolitan area, just a short drive away, hosts several accredited facilities offering various levels of care. This includes medical detoxification programs, which provide a safe, supervised environment to manage withdrawal symptoms, a crucial first phase for many. Following detox, inpatient or residential treatment programs offer intensive therapy and structure, while outpatient programs allow individuals to receive treatment while maintaining their daily responsibilities at home or work. Many of these centers accept insurance and offer sliding scale fees to improve accessibility.

Recovery is more than just stopping substance use; it is about building a new, fulfilling life. Effective treatment programs in our area address the whole person. This means incorporating individual counseling to understand the root causes of addiction, group therapy to build connection and reduce isolation, and often family therapy to heal relationships. For residents of Tanner, integrating local support systems is invaluable. Attending regular meetings of support groups like Alcoholics Anonymous or Narcotics Anonymous in nearby Athens or Huntsville can provide ongoing encouragement and accountability from others who truly understand the journey.
